About the role

The Dosimetrist designs accurate treatment plans using computer or manual computation to deliver prescribed radiation doses as directed by the Radiation Oncologist. They also perform and verify calculations, assist in patient simulation, and participate in brachytherapy procedures and quality assurance programs.

Job Summary and Responsibilities As a Dosimetrist, you will work under the supervision of the Lead Physicist to assist the Radiation Oncologist in providing safe and effective treatment to radiation therapy patients.Every day you will perform specific duties under the overall direction of medical physicists and direct supervision of the Lead Medical Physicist, ensuring precise treatment planning and delivery.

You will also be responsible for renewing credentials annually and adhering to ethical standards.To be successful in this role, you will demonstrate meticulous attention to detail, a strong understanding of radiation oncology principles, and the ability to work collaboratively within a highly specialized team to ensure optimal patient outcomes and safety.

Designs accurate treatment plans by means of computer and/or manual computation that delivers prescribed radiation doses as prescribed by the treating radiation oncologist.

Performs, verifies and documents calculations for the delivery of the prescribed dose and subsequent documentation in patient files and verifies accuracy of calculations using guidelines established by the medical physicist.

Assists in the simulation process to ensure optimal patient position, immobilization and adequate scans for treatment planning.

Participates in aspects of high and low dose brachytherapy procedures that include (but not limited to) implanting of brachytherapy devices, planning, calculations, and quality assurance measures in compliance with hospital, state and federal regulations.

Assists in quality improvement and quality assurance programs/procedures done by the medical physicist to ensure the accuracy and safety of treatments.

Participates in continuing education of treatment planning techniques, current advances in medical dosimetry and the clinical development and implementation of new therapy techniques in the department.

Job Requirements Required Bachelors Of Science in closely related field and Previous radiation therapy experience, upon hire Certified Medical Dosimetrist, within 6 - months and Registered Technologist Radiation Therapy, upon hire Basic Life Support - CPR, upon hire

Requirements

Candidates must possess a Bachelor of Science in a closely related field and have previous radiation therapy experience upon hire. Certification as a Medical Dosimetrist is required within six months, along with Registered Technologist Radiation Therapy status upon hire.
